    I would hold on to the house with an alt if you decide to look for a new FC on your main. Houses aren't as easy to come by, and if you release this one while being in another FC with a house, you won't be able to pick one up for your existing FC again. I know some folks might frown on that advice, but your FC did build it up, so it's technically yours to keep and decorate. The house probably took time and resources to obtain, and if by any chance your friends do return, you might want to use it again in the future.

    Also, if things don't work out in your FC search, you might find yourself wanting to return to your original FC. Building up a FC is time consuming... but not impossible, especially not with a new patch having just dropped. You just have to decide if running a FC is something you want to do. It does add a whole new dynamic and responsibility to the game if you go that direction, and it's not for everyone.
